WebJun 3, 2009 · Mechanism of action. Like other penicillin drugs, it inhibits the last stage of bacterial cell wall synthesis by binding to penicillin binding proteins, which inhibits the cross-linking needed to form stable cell walls. WebJun 7, 2024 · The transpeptidase enzyme that performs this step is inhibited by floxapen syp. As a result the bacterial cellwall is weakened, the cell swells and then ruptures. floxapen syp resists the action of bacterial penicillinase probably because of the steric hindrance induced by the acyl side chain which prevents the opening of the β- lactam ring.
Web1. What Floxapen is and what it is used for Floxapen is an antibiotic used to treat infections by killing the bacteria that can cause them. It belongs to a group of antibiotics called “penicillins”. Floxapen capsules are used to treat a wide range of infections caused by bacteria, such as: chest infections throat or nose infections Flucloxacillin, also known as floxacillin, is an antibiotic used to treat skin infections, external ear infections, infections of leg ulcers, diabetic foot infections, and infection of bone. It may be used together with other medications to treat pneumonia, and endocarditis. It may also be used prior to surgery to prevent Staphylococcus infections. It is not effective against methicillin-resistant Staphylococcus aureus (MRSA). It is taken by mouth or given by injection into a vein or muscle.
